Origin of International Migrants Residing in Brazil, 2020

WorldGeopolitical
Number of foreign-born people living in Brazil as of 2015, by country of origin
UN
In 2015, persons from several countries resided in Brazil. Countries with more than 22,500 migrants were the United States, Bolivia, Paraguay, Uruguay, Argentina, Portugal, Spain, Italy, China, and Japan. Between 16,900 and 22,500 migrants originated from Peru, Chile, and Germany. Between 5,620 and 11,200 migrants originated from Colombia, Angola, United Kingdom, and South Korea. Most of the remaining countries of the world had fewer than 5,620 migrants to Brazil. Countries in this category with at least 3,000 migrants were Mexico, Venezuela, Egypt, the Netherlands, Poland and Switzerland.
